Car Seat Headrest Returns with Rock Opera Album ‘The Scholars’

Indie rockers Car Seat Headrest are back with their first album in five years, a concept album titled “The Scholars.” Frontman Will Toledo cites inspirations from Shakespeare, Mozart, and David Bowie’s Ziggy Stardust. The album is an honest-to-goodness rock opera, featuring original characters, a reincarnation storyline, and themes of yearning, youth, and religious anxiety.

According to Toledo, the band’s prolonged inactivity was due to COVID-19 infections, which inspired a new spiritual practice that influenced some of the album’s themes. The Scholars will feature 13 tracks, including the single “Gethsemane,” along with an accompanying 13-minute black-and-white video.

The album’s plot follows Rosa, who studies at Parnassus University and discovers she has healing powers after bringing a patient back to life. As she absorbs pain from others, reality blurs, and she encounters ancient beings controlling the medical school. The Scholars will be released on May 2, with Car Seat Headrest announcing several tour dates starting in May.
